Abstract
Motion of floating wind turbines has been studied. A literature study on different concepts and what tools are available for simulating them is presented. Marintek’s simulation software SIMO is used for time simulations. In the calculations, the hydrodynamic forces, mooring line forces and aerodynamic forces from the tower and rotor are taken into account. In addition a pitch control algorithm is used for the rotor blades. Results are compared to available experimental results from model tests. The structure studied is a 5 MW version of the Hywind concept.
